Director; appointment; compensation and expenses. (1) The Land Conservation and Development Commission shall appoint a person to serve as the Director of the Department of Land Conservation and Development. The director shall hold the office of the director at the pleasure of the commission and the salary of the director shall be fixed by the commission unless otherwise provided by law. (2) In addition to salary, the director shall be reimbursed, subject to any applicable law regulating travel and other expenses of state officers and employees, for actual and necessary expenses incurred by the director in the performance of official duties. [1973 c.80 §13]
